## Authentication

Welcome aboard! FeedCheckly validates podcast feeds by calling our internal Warblegate service, and that call needs credentials. Nothing fancy — just a single API key in the auth header. Each team member gets their own, but for your first week you can use the shared dev key while yours gets provisioned. Don't commit it anywhere, obviously. Here's the shared dev key you'll need:

service key, kafop-bafog: zpat11_KsCm4B2HfZn

## Changelog — Ticktrace 1.9

### Renamed: DRIFT_API_TOKEN
During the cron drift investigation we found plugins confusing this variable with the metrics token, so it has been renamed to indicate it authorizes drift-report uploads specifically. Plugin authors must read the new name from 1.9 onward; the old name is ignored without warning. Sample env files in the SDK are updated. In your deployment env file, the drift-report upload secret is set on the next line.

env line for fawef-taguf: VAULT_KEY13=a9695905a9a90

Subject: Handover — Brickport incremental rebuilds

Hey all — quick handover before the sync. Incremental rebuilds on Brickport are stable now; only touched pages regenerate, full builds are down to nightly. Watch the dependency graph cache — if it goes stale, force a full rebuild. Publishing to the edge requires signing the build manifest with the key below.

signing key of bagap-yawep = bky13_TbfT6ZMUoGJo2

# Heads up, on-call: these knobs control how hard the Driftwell parity checker
# leans on partner feeds. If alerts are screaming about mismatch floods, it's
# usually a feed hiccup — widen the tolerance or stretch the poll interval
# before paging anyone upstream. Revert after the incident, please.
# The tunable constants are right below:

tuning table, yajog-yahof:
BUDGETS = {
    "lamvan": 303,
    "wenox": 460,
    "fenvan": 525,
}